UK Government support
You may be eligible for postgraduate loan funding from the UK Government via Student Finance England, Student Finance Wales, or Student Award Agency Scotland.
This can provide funding support towards the cost of your postgraduate programme and differs depending on where you reside in the UK.
If you live in England
If your postgraduate course starts on or after 1 August 2025, you may be eligible to receive a postgraduate master’s loan of up to £12,858 through Student Finance England.

If you live in Wales
If your course starts on or after 1 August 2025, you may be eligible for a combination of loan and grant with a maximum of £19,255 depending on your household income.

If you live in Scotland
If your course starts on or after 1 August 2025, you may be eligible for a tuition fee loan of up to £7,000 for full-time postgraduate courses. Eligible students can also apply for a living-cost loan of up to £6,900. For the 2024/25 academic year, the amount of loan you are entitled to will include a £2,400 Special Support Loan.
